Ex Machina is a masterclass in psychological tension that blurs the lines between creator and creation. Directed by Alex Garland, this 2014 film stands as a pillar of modern science fiction by focusing on the intimate and often unsettling relationship between humans and artificial intelligence. What begins as a scientific breakthrough quickly devolves into a dark, claustrophobic mystery. As the "sessions" progress, the drama intensifies. Ava proves to be far more self-aware and deceptive than Caleb could have imagined, leading him to question Nathan’s true motives and even his own reality.
